CLEBURNE, Texas (Sep. 5, 2021) – The Cleburne Railroaders secured their first-ever playoff berth by virtue of a loss from the Lincoln Saltdogs, but could not rally themselves as the Kansas City Monarchs snuck away with a 5-4 win on Sunday night at The Depot at Cleburne Station. Lincoln’s defeat earlier in the evening to the Houston Apollos guarantees that the Railroaders will play in Wednesday’s South Division Wild Card game, but neither the opponent nor the location has been decided. Cleburne can clinch home field for that contest with a win on Monday or a Sioux City loss.Kansas City (68-31) quickly pounced for a 3-0 lead, scoring once in the second on a sacrifice fly from Paulo Orlando and twice in the third on run-scoring singles from Darnell Sweeney and Ibandel Isabel.
